Output e74f28a61b682a42d3ee3e5e7164c4296e68a74d08182fe7f07c3bdf842f7be0:1

value
538805903
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d786976365d2acd421ecb6a69cee2e5f7a90807 OP_EQUALVERIFY OP_CHECKSIG
address
1Du2XREHuSVjZmrFTRGtgRdpSNfA9P89f3
transaction
e74f28a61b682a42d3ee3e5e7164c4296e68a74d08182fe7f07c3bdf842f7be0
spent
true